Salim Stoudamire Signs with Reno Bighorns

January 5, 2011 - NBA G League (G League)
Reno Bighorns News Release


RENO, Nev.- The Reno Bighorns acquired former Atlanta Hawk guard Salim Stoudamire yesterday from the NBA Development League's available player pool, adding another veteran point guard to the Bighorns roster.

Stoudamire, who played collegiately at the University of Arizona, was the Atlanta Hawks second round pick (31st overall) in the 2005 NBA Draft. Over three seasons in Atlanta, the 6-1, 175-pound point guard appeared in 157 NBA games, including one start. Stoudamire averaged 8.0 ppg and shot 36.6% from beyond the arc during his time with the Hawks.

During his collegiate career, Stoudamire averaged 15.2 ppg with the Wildcats. He appeared in 129-career games, and averaged at least 12 points per game in each of his four seasons.

Stoudamire joins Reno after spending the first nine games of this season with the Idaho Stampede. While with Idaho, he averaged 13.2 ppg and 3.7 apg. Stoudamire scored a season-high 23 points against the Bighorns on Dec. 1 in a 127-117 Bighorns victory.
